Colin Calloway - author of The Indian World of George Washington: The First President, the First Americans, and the Birth of the Nation - talked about Washington and his relationship with Native Americans. He explained that Washington first interacted with them during the Seven Years War, and later was quick to recognize their importance to the survival and growth of the young nation. George Washington University hosted this event. close
